What Are Backlinks?
A backlink is a link from one website to another. If a local news site, contractor directory, supplier website, or home improvement blog links to your roofing company’s website, that is a backlink.
Search engines view backlinks as signals of confidence. When reputable websites link to your content, they are effectively saying your business is credible and worth referencing. The more quality backlinks you earn, the stronger your website appears in the eyes of search engines.
Think of backlinks as digital referrals. Just as word-of-mouth recommendations help roofing companies earn trust offline, backlinks help build trust online.

Backlinks Build Domain Authority
Although “domain authority” is not an official Google metric, it is widely used to describe the overall strength and trustworthiness of a website. Sites with stronger backlink profiles usually have more authority and better ranking potential.
For roofing businesses, this matters because higher authority helps rank not only the homepage, but also service pages, blog posts, city landing pages, and specialty roofing pages.
For example, if your site has earned backlinks from local organizations, suppliers, chambers of commerce, and respected blogs, your pages for roof repair, shingle replacement, and storm restoration all gain stronger ranking potential.
That means backlinks can improve visibility across your entire website, not just one page.
Local SEO Benefits for Roofing Contractors
Most roofing companies depend on local leads. You want homeowners in your service area to find you first when they need help. Local backlinks are especially valuable because they reinforce geographic relevance.
Examples of valuable local backlinks include:
- Chamber of commerce websites
- Local business directories
- Community sponsorship pages
- Local newspapers
- Real estate agencies
- Property management companies
- Home builders and remodelers
- Local charities or events
If multiple trusted local websites link to your roofing business, search engines gain stronger confidence that you are a real and relevant company serving that region.
This can improve rankings in both traditional search results and map listings.

Quality Matters More Than Quantity
Many roofing companies make the mistake of chasing hundreds of cheap backlinks from irrelevant or spammy websites. This approach can waste money and may even harm SEO performance.
Search engines care far more about quality than raw numbers.
A few backlinks from trusted, relevant websites can be more valuable than dozens of low-quality links.
For roofing businesses, ideal backlinks come from:
- Local organizations
- Construction or home improvement websites
- Roofing manufacturers
- Supplier directories
- Reputable media outlets
- Real estate or property management sites
- Industry associations
- High-quality blogs related to homes or remodeling
Relevant links signal real authority. Random links from unrelated sites rarely provide the same value.

Safe Ways to Build Roofing Backlinks
The best backlink strategies focus on real relationships and real value.
Effective methods include:
1. Local Partnerships
Connect with builders, plumbers, electricians, HVAC companies, and remodelers for mutual referrals and website mentions.
2. Supplier and Manufacturer Listings
Many roofing brands maintain contractor directories. Get listed whenever possible.
3. Community Sponsorships
Sponsor youth sports teams, events, nonprofits, or charity programs that publish supporter links.
4. PR and Media Outreach
Share stories about storm response efforts, business milestones, or community projects with local journalists.
5. Helpful Blog Content
Publish expert advice homeowners actually need.
6. Testimonials
Provide testimonials for software vendors, suppliers, or partners who may feature your business on their site.
These strategies create durable backlinks that align with search engine guidelines.
